Ingredients You’ll Need:

  • 1 large head of cauliflower, cut into florets
  • 1 tablespoon olive oil
  • 1 teaspoon cumin seeds
  • 1 teaspoon coriander seeds
  • 1 teaspoon turmeric powder
  • 1/2 teaspoon ground ginger
  • 1/4 teaspoon cayenne pepper (optional)
  • 1/2 teaspoon salt
  • 1/4 teaspoon black pepper
  • 1/2 cup water
  • 1/4 cup chopped fresh cilantro

Step-by-Step Instructions:

1. Prepare the Cauliflower: Preheat your oven to 400°F (200°C). Toss the cauliflower florets with olive oil and spread them on a baking sheet.
2. Roast the Cauliflower: Roast the cauliflower for 20-25 minutes, or until tender and slightly browned.
3. Toast the Spices: While the cauliflower roasts, heat a small skillet over medium heat. Add the cumin, coriander, turmeric, ginger, and cayenne pepper (if using). Toast the spices for 1-2 minutes, or until fragrant.
4. Add the Spices to the Cauliflower: Transfer the roasted cauliflower to a large bowl. Add the toasted spices, salt, and pepper.
5. Add the Water: Pour 1/2 cup of water into the bowl and stir to combine.
6. Cover and Simmer: Cover the bowl and simmer the cauliflower over low heat for 10-15 minutes, or until the cauliflower is fully cooked and the liquid has been absorbed.
7. Garnish and Serve: Stir in the chopped cilantro and serve the cauliflower warm as a side dish or as part of a main meal.

Tips for Success:

  • For a crispy cauliflower, roast it at a higher temperature (425-450°F) for a shorter time (15-20 minutes).
  • To add more flavor, drizzle the cauliflower with a squeeze of lemon juice or a splash of soy sauce before serving.
  • If you don’t have fresh spices, you can use 1/2 teaspoon of each ground spice instead.
  • This ‘jamie oliver cauliflower recipe’ is also a great way to use up leftover roasted cauliflower.

Variations on the Theme:

  • Roasted Cauliflower with Cheese: Sprinkle grated Parmesan cheese over the cauliflower before roasting.
  • Cauliflower with Tahini Sauce: Serve the cauliflower with a drizzle of creamy tahini sauce for a rich and nutty flavor.
  • Cauliflower and Chickpea Curry: Add a can of chickpeas to the recipe and simmer in a curry sauce for a hearty and flavorful dish.

Health Benefits of Cauliflower:

  • Rich in Antioxidants: Cauliflower contains antioxidants that help protect cells from damage caused by free radicals.
  • Supports Digestion: The fiber in cauliflower promotes healthy digestion and regularity.
  • Lowers Cholesterol: The soluble fiber in cauliflower can help lower cholesterol levels.
  • May Reduce Inflammation: Some studies suggest that cauliflower may have anti-inflammatory properties.

Beyond the Recipe:

  • Cauliflower Pizza Crust: Use cauliflower florets instead of flour to create a delicious and low-carb pizza crust.
  • Cauliflower Rice: Pulse cauliflower florets in a food processor to make a healthy and gluten-free alternative to rice.
  • Cauliflower Mashed Potatoes: Steam cauliflower florets and mash them with butter and milk for a creamy and nutritious side dish.
